-
-
GoogleはGoogle Kubernetes Engineにサービスメッシュを提供する「Istio」を統合し、マネージドサービスとして提供することを発表しました。ベータ版として提供されます。 Dockerの登場によってコンテナ型仮想化が注目されるようになり、その次に注目されるようになったのは多数のコンテナをクラスタとして管理するオーケストレーションツールの「Kubernetes」でした。 そしてその次に注目されようとしているのが、クラスタの上で実行される分散アプリケーショ……
-
お、いままだ無料のVMで走らせていたGitLab RunnerをCloud Runに移そう! と思ったけど、listenするほうじゃないと移せないのか…
-
-
-
-
-
-
-
-
GitHubが主催するイベント「GitHub Universe 2018」が、サンフランシスコで開幕しました。 初日の基調講演で同社は「Pull Request以来もっとも大きな新機能」(同社シニアバイスプレジデント Jason Warner氏)とするGitHubの新機能「GitHub Actions」を発表しました。 GitHub Actionsとは、GitHubのイベントをトリガーとして任意のDockerコンテナの実行を連係させていくことにより、ユーザーが自由にワーク……
-
-
マイクロソフトは開発者向けイベントMicrosoft Connect(); 2018を開催。基調講演で、複数のサービスなどから構成されるクラウドアプリケーションを1つにパッケージするための仕様「CNAB」(Cloud Native Application Bundle)を発表しました。 CNABにはマイクロソフトだけでなく、Docker、HashiCorp、bitnamiらが協力しています。 クラウドに対応したアプリケーションは一般に、さまざまなアプリケーションやサービス……
-
-
-
-
-
Dockerイメージの作成まずはmovidiusの環境が入ったDockerイメージを作成します。Dockerファイルの中身としては、OpenCVとcaffe環境、およびMovidius NCSのライブラリをインストールします。
-
RaspberryPi用のイメージは「rpi-****」と、プレフィックスにrpiが付きます。DockerHubで検索してみてください。
-
docker runの -pオプションの使い方 -p ホスト
-
resin/raspberrypi3* Raspberry Pi向けDockerイメージ
-
systemdの稼働中のUnitで、「docker-<コンテナID>.scope」という名前のUnitができています。 # systemctl --full | grep docker-d572763fd9f7 # systemctl status $unitname -l
-
-
-
-
systemdのオプションを変更するには
-
-
-
-
-
docker inspect --format で使うgoテンプレートの形式
-
Linuxカーネル5.8にしたらCAP_PERFMONがGitLabのDockerコンテナ起動時にエラーを発生したので調べていたら見つけた。
[20.10 beta] Unknown capability "CAP_PERFMON" on Linux 5.8.14 #41562
-
-
Debian testing(strech)にしたらdockerがたちあがらくなったけど、DOCKER_OPTS="--storage-driver=aufs"で復活。ただ、これだと4.1 kernelではaufsないので動かない
-
UbuntuにCUDAやnvidia-dockerをインストールする方法が詳しく載っている
-
Linuxカーネル5.8で、GitLabのDockerイメージを起動しようとすると、cap_add
-
Use docker-in-docker executor
-
ローカルにたくさんDockerコンテナ走っていて重いので、リモートでDevContainerしたくなったので。
setting.jsonにdocker.hostの行を追加してVS Codeを再起動
"docker.host"
-
-
Windows版docker cliコマンド ビルド手順
1. ソースの取得
git clone https
-
-
-
-
Dockerは、コンテナランタイム実行用のLinux環境を構築できるツールキット「LinuxKit」を発表した。
-
-
-
-
-
-
docker-compose down で失敗する時 # grep -Hir 47a7f24a /proc/*/mountinfo
-
ENTRYPOINT とCMD の両方が書いてある場合には、CMD に書かれている内容が、ENTRYPOINT に書いてあるcommand のオプションとして実行されます。
-
配列にしないとsh -c で実行される。 ENTRYPOINT CMD とつながる。 CMDは、docker run/execの引数で置き換えられる
-
-
docker上にkubernetesを構築する
-
Amazon EC2のAmazon LinuxでDocker
-
-
-
Debian系ディストリビューションでは、OSの稼動に最低限必要なファイルなどを指定したディレクトリにインストールする「debootstrap」というコマンドが用意されており、これを使ってOS環境を構築できる。まずはこのdebootstrapをインストールする。
-
-
GitLab 9.0をコンテナにデプロイし、Kubernetesでオーケストレーションされている状態で、CPUとメモリ消費量のモニタリングが可能です。
-
コマンド体系の変更, Docker 17.05で導入された「マルチステージビルド」。
-
-
-
-
-
-
-
Dockerの起動まで
-
-
-
-
-
Rancher DesktopはK8s環境下と思いきやDockerコマンドも使えるらしい。Docker Composeも!
-
コンテナイメージのセキュリティを確保する一助となる。また、米国家安全保障局の「Security-Enhanced Linux」(SELinux)はDockerのデーモンを強化できる。
-
コンテナ開発の現実
-
-
「多数のサーバーを1つのコンピューターとして見せる」
-
docker exec -t -i server /bin/sh
-
-
今時はoverlay2 これってzfs上でも使えるのかな?
-
-
そう、おうちのDNSサーバもDockerにアクセス許可出してなかった
-
Minimal Ubuntu, on public clouds and Docker Hub(Canonical公式ブログより) Canonicalは2018年7月9日(米国時間)、パブリッククラウドおよびDocker Hubに最適したLinuxディストリビューション「Minimal Ubuntu」をリリースしたことを明らかにした。AWS(Amazon Web Services)およびGCP(Google Cloud Platform)を推奨パブリッククラウドとし、イメージファイルはWeb上からダウンロ
-
Dockerだと高負荷時に性能劣化するらしいが、理由がなぜだか掴めず
-
-
-
さくらインターネットは3月26日、米Dockerが開発するコンテナ型仮想化技術「Docker」を利用した新たなホスティングサービス「Arukas(アルカス)」の提供を開始した。
-
Docker 1.10以前の etcdなどを利用した連携
-
-
Windows, MacOS,さくら でのDockerの導入
-
-
-
米Microsoftと米Dockerは、クラウドアプリケーションをパッケージ化する方法の標準化を目指す新しい仕様「Cloud Native Application Bundle(CNAB)」を共同で発表した。クラウド技術の種類を問わずに分散アプリケーションをパッケージ化するためのオープンソースの仕様だとMicrosoftは説明しており、ワークステーション上のDockerやクラウド上のKubernetesなど、さまざまなコンピューティング環境に対応する。
-
+GRUB_CMDLINE_LINUX_DEFAULT="quiet nomodeset systemd.legacy_systemd_cgroup_controller=yes"
-
AzureのDockerでCentOSを動かす
-
まだWindowsでのDockerはクライアントだけ…
-
アパッチ メソス クラスターマネージャー コンテナもね 分散リソース管理
-
-
-
-
わざわざWindwosにする理由が無いけどメモ
-
-
-
-
GCEは「Dockerが動くよ」って事なので、Docker imageがそのまま動き始めるAmazonEC2の方が楽
-
dockerコンテナ版 docker-registry
-
Windows版「Oracle VM VirtualBox」「Vagrant」「Git」であっというまにUbuntuが動き出してその上でDockerできる
-
2013年3月に登場し、あっという間に多くのシステムで採用されるようになったオープンソースのコンテナ技術「Docker」。同じように、ITシステムの在り方に大きな影響を与えた「仮想化」「クラウド」といった技術と比べ、何が違うのか。そして、どのように向き合えば、より多くのメリットを得られるのだろうか。2017年2月27日に開催された@IT主催セミナーの模様から探っていこう。
-
オラクルがDockerと提携。Docker Storeで自社の主力データベース、ミドルウェア、開発者ツールをDockerコンテナとして提供を開始した。
-
-
-
-
-
-
本連載では、サービスの開発、提供のアジリティ向上の一助となることを目的として、企業における「Kubernetes」の活用について解説する。初回は、Kubernetesを使う上で前提となる「Docker」についておさらいし、Kubernetesの概要や起源、現状などを紹介する。
-
-
技術担当者は4つのステップを踏んで、リソースを浪費することなく、プロジェクトを確実に進められるよう準備した上で、Dockerコンテナの導入を開始しなければならない。
-
Swarm mode, Cypt, API, Build-in routing
-
runCのその後は?
-
VMの上でDockerが動くのではなく、VMのようにDockerコンテナが動く